PARKING BRAKE:DRIVELINE:HYDRAULIC:HOSES, LINES/PIPING, AND FITTINGSVEHICLE DESCRIPTION: TRUCK BODIES INSTALLED ON NAVISTAR 1652C CHASSIS AND EQUIPPED WITH AUTOMATIC TRANSMISSIONS. THE PARKING BRAKE WAS ROUTED SO THAT IT CAN CONTACT THE LEFT FRONT TIRE. THIS CONTACT CAN CAUSE THE PROTECTIVE SHEATH TO BE WORN AWAY, POTENTIALLY CAUSING FAILURE OF THE CABLE.

Our database holds 3 NHTSA owner-reported complaints filed against Grumman vehicles. Our database also holds 28 safety recall campaigns and 3 NHTSA investigations covering at least one Grumman model year.
Complaints are reports submitted by owners and drivers to NHTSA. They are not verified and do not establish that a defect exists.

TRAILER HITCHESA 2" BALL WAS TO BE WELDED TO A STEEL BAR AS WELL AS THE NUT FOR THE BALL WELDED TO THE SHANK. SOME VEHICLES WERE NOT PROPERLY WELDED ALLOWING THE NUT TO COME OFF.
ELECTRICAL SYSTEM:12V/24V/48V BATTERY:CABLESTHE BATTERY CABLES WERE LOCATED EITHER ADJACENT TO OR TOUCHING THE TURBOCHARGER OF THE ENGINE. HIGH TEMPERATURES OF THE TURBOCHARGER CAN MELT THE CABLE INSULATION, CAUSING AN ELECTRICAL SHORT CIRCUIT.
